To print a hollow pyramid pattern in TypeScript, you can follow similar logic as JavaScript using nested loops.
In this example,
function printHollowPyramid(rows: number): void {
for (let i = 1; i <= rows; i++) {
let pattern = '';
for (let j = i; j < rows; j++) {
pattern += ' ';
}
for (let k = 1; k < (2 * i); k++) {
if (k === 1 || k === (2 * i - 1) || i === rows) {
pattern += '* ';
} else {
pattern += ' ';
}
}
console.log(pattern);
}
}
printHollowPyramid(5);
